After undergoing Thermage treatment in Camperdown, it's crucial to follow specific post-procedure guidelines to ensure optimal results and minimize any potential risks. Here are some key things to avoid:
Avoid Hot Baths and Saunas: For at least 48 hours after the treatment, steer clear of hot baths, saunas, and steam rooms. These can increase skin temperature, potentially causing discomfort or affecting the healing process.
Do Not Expose Treated Skin to Direct Sunlight: Protect your skin from direct sunlight, especially in the first few days post-treatment. Use a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30 to prevent sunburn and reduce the risk of hyperpigmentation.
Avoid Strenuous Exercise: Refrain from intense physical activities for at least 24 hours. Sweating can irritate the skin and may interfere with the natural healing process.
Do Not Apply Harsh Skincare Products: Avoid using any harsh or abrasive skincare products, including exfoliants, retinoids, and alpha-hydroxy acids, for at least a week. These can cause irritation and may disrupt the skin's recovery.
Avoid Scratching or Picking at the Skin: Resist the urge to scratch or pick at any areas that may feel dry or flaky. Allow the skin to naturally exfoliate itself to avoid any scarring or infection.
Do Not Use Makeup Immediately: If possible, avoid wearing makeup for the first 24 hours post-treatment. If makeup is necessary, ensure it is non-comedogenic and gentle on the skin.
By adhering to these guidelines, you can help ensure a smooth recovery and maximize the benefits of your Thermage treatment in Camperdown. Always consult with your healthcare provider for personalized advice tailored to your specific situation.

Understanding Post-Thermage Care in Camperdown
After undergoing Thermage treatment in Camperdown, it is crucial to follow a specific aftercare routine to ensure optimal results and minimize any potential risks. One of the most important aspects of this aftercare is protecting your skin from direct sunlight. Here’s why and how you should do it.
Why Avoid Direct Sunlight?
Direct sunlight can be particularly harmful to the skin immediately following Thermage treatment. The procedure stimulates collagen production, which can make the skin more sensitive and prone to damage. Exposure to UV rays can lead to sunburn, exacerbate redness, and potentially cause hyperpigmentation, which can undo the positive effects of the treatment.
When to Start Protecting Your Skin
It is advisable to begin protecting your skin from the sun as soon as you leave the clinic. However, the first few days post-treatment are the most critical. During this period, your skin is in a state of recovery, and any additional stress, such as sun exposure, can hinder the healing process.
Choosing the Right Sunscreen
Using a sunscreen with a high SPF value is essential. Look for products that offer broad-spectrum protection, meaning they shield against both UVA and UVB rays. An SPF of at least 30 is recommended, but higher values can provide additional protection, especially if you plan to be outdoors for extended periods.
Additional Sun Protection Measures
In addition to sunscreen, consider other measures to protect your skin. Wearing a wide-brimmed hat and sunglasses can provide extra protection for your face and eyes. Lightweight, long-sleeved clothing can also be beneficial, especially if you are in a sunny environment.
Consistency is Key
Consistency in applying sunscreen is vital. Reapply every two hours, or more frequently if you are swimming or sweating. Even on cloudy days, UV rays can penetrate the atmosphere, so it’s important to maintain a routine of sun protection.
Consult Your Doctor
If you have any concerns about your skin’s reaction to sunlight post-Thermage, or if you notice any unusual symptoms, it is always best to consult your doctor. They can provide personalized advice and ensure that your aftercare routine is tailored to your specific needs.
